虚拟机安装教程win10bootmanager,虚拟机安装Windows 10全流程指南,从环境配置到Boot Manager故障修复的深度解析
- 综合资讯
- 2025-04-19 06:04:21
- 2

虚拟机安装Windows 10全流程指南从环境配置到Boot Manager故障修复,系统梳理技术要点,教程首先指导用户选择VMware、VirtualBox或Hype...
虚拟机安装Windows 10全流程指南从环境配置到Boot Manager故障修复,系统梳理技术要点,教程首先指导用户选择VMware、VirtualBox或Hyper-V等虚拟化平台,配置虚拟硬件参数(如内存≥4GB、虚拟硬盘≥100GB),并下载官方ISO镜像文件,安装阶段详解分区规划(推荐使用MBR分区表)、引导选项设置及网络配置,重点演示DOS命令行下的bcdboot工具修复引导记录,针对常见Boot Manager故障,提供双重验证方案:一是在虚拟机内通过"修复计算机-疑难解答-启动修复"自动修复;二是通过Windows安装介质启动执行"bcdedit /set bootmanager bootmgr"命令,最后通过虚拟机快照功能实现系统还原,确保安装过程可回溯,全文涵盖从环境搭建到故障排查的完整技术链路,特别强化引导系统底层修复逻辑,适合开发者构建标准化虚拟测试环境。
(全文共计3876字,含6大核心模块及12项技术细节)
虚拟机Windows 10安装基础认知(421字) 1.1 虚拟机安装的本质原理
- 通过Hypervisor层实现物理资源虚拟化(Intel VT-x/AMD-V技术解析)
- 虚拟磁盘的动态扩展机制(VMDK/VHDX文件结构对比)
- 引导加载程序(Boot Manager)的层级关系:MBR→GPT→EFI系统 partition→bootx64.efi
2 关键硬件要求清单
- CPU:支持硬件虚拟化的处理器(推荐i5-8代以上/AMD Ryzen 2000系列)
- 内存:至少4GB(建议8GB+,保障安装过程流畅度)
- 存储:虚拟磁盘建议20GB+(SSD模式优先)
- 主板:UEFI功能启用(BIOS设置关键点)
虚拟机环境搭建规范(638字) 2.1 虚拟化平台选择对比 | 平台 | 优势 | 劣势 | 适用场景 | |------------|-----------------------|-----------------------|------------------| | VMware Workstation | 支持硬件辅助虚拟化 |许可费用较高 |企业级开发环境 | | VirtualBox | 开源免费 | 性能优化较弱 |个人学习环境 | | Hyper-V | 深度集成Windows系统 | 仅限Windows主机 |企业级测试环境 |
图片来源于网络,如有侵权联系删除
2 环境配置黄金参数
- 内存分配:动态+固定混合模式(建议初始2GB+动态增长)
- 磁盘类型:选择"单分区( Primary partition )"而非动态磁盘
- 调制解调器:禁用网络加速(避免驱动冲突)
- 处理器选项:启用"虚拟化软加速"(VT-d技术)
- 显示器分辨率:建议1920×1080@60Hz(避免图形驱动问题)
3 磁盘初始化关键步骤
- 创建物理磁盘:选择"使用整个磁盘"而非自定义分区
- 分区表类型:UEFI系统必须选择GPT(MBR会导致启动失败)
- 主分区数量:仅创建一个系统分区(约200MB引导分区+剩余主分区)
Windows 10安装过程深度解析(1024字) 3.1 ISO文件准备阶段
- 压缩包处理:使用7-Zip解压(避免WinRAR虚拟光驱兼容性问题)
- 网络校验:通过Microsoft官方下载工具验证 hashes值
- 启动修复:使用DISM命令修复可能存在的介质损坏
2 引导菜单选择技巧
- UEFI模式:在BIOS中设置Secure Boot为"禁用"
- Legacy模式:适用于旧版虚拟机(可能引发引导程序冲突)
- 引导设备选择:确保选择"虚拟机光驱"而非主机光盘
3 分区配置核心要点
- 分区大小计算公式:系统分区=MBR(100MB)或GPT(200MB)+剩余空间90%
- 扩展分区创建:仅当需要安装其他操作系统时创建
- 分区标签:系统分区建议使用NTFS(exFAT可能引发文件系统错误)
4 安装过程关键参数设置
- 语言选择:推荐使用"英语(美国)"避免字符编码问题
- 输入法:简体中文(需提前安装输入法包)
- 网络配置:自动获取IP(避免169.254.x.x地址导致激活失败)
- 用户账户:建议创建管理员账户(避免家庭版功能限制)
5 安装过程中可能出现的5类异常
- 磁盘格式化失败:检查虚拟磁盘是否处于"只读"状态
- 启动项加载延迟:等待30秒以上系统初始化完成
- 语言包下载中断:使用安装介质中的语言包文件覆盖
- 驱动签名错误:在安装过程中选择"忽略警告"
- 系统更新失败:安装完成后立即运行sfc /scannow
Boot Manager故障诊断与修复(876字) 4.1 典型Boot Manager错误代码
- 0x0000007B:磁盘模式不匹配(UEFI与Legacy混用)
- 0x0000003F:引导记录损坏(需要重建MBR/GPT)
- 0x00001234:虚拟机配置错误(Hypervisor版本不兼容)
2 系统启动失败应急处理流程
- 介质启动:插入Windows 10安装盘,选择"修复计算机"
- 命令行工具:重点使用以下命令:
- diskpart:检查磁盘状态(
list disk
) - bootrec:重建引导记录(
fixboot C:
) - bcdedit:编辑引导配置(
set safeboot=Minimal
)
- diskpart:检查磁盘状态(
- 磁盘修复:运行
chkdsk /f /r
并确认错误修正
3 虚拟机专用修复方案
- VMware Workstation:使用VMware Tools修复引导(菜单:虚拟机→安装VMware Tools)
- VirtualBox:安装引导修复补丁(通过VBoxManage命令更新引导扇区)
- Hyper-V:启用自动修复功能(设置→硬件→虚拟化设置→引导修复)
4 深度分析引导程序结构
- MBR引导扇区:前446字节为引导代码,446-610字节为分区表
- GPT引导元数据:占用1MB空间,包含 Protective MBR等关键信息
- EFI系统分区:必须包含EFI/Windows目录及bootx64.efi文件
- BCD store文件:存储引导配置信息的XML格式数据库
高级配置与性能优化(583字) 5.1 虚拟机性能调优参数
图片来源于网络,如有侵权联系删除
- 分页文件设置:禁用(通过regedit修改 HKLM\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management\CommitPerProcess)
- 虚拟化增强:在虚拟机设置中启用"允许硬件辅助虚拟化"
- 虚拟磁盘模式:选择"独立(Split)"而非"联机(Concatenated)"
- 网络适配器:禁用Jumbo Frames(MTU>1500可能导致数据包损坏)
2 系统安全加固措施
- 禁用不必要的服务:通过msconfig禁用Print Spooler等
- 启用Windows Defender ATP:通过注册表启用云端防护
- 添加虚拟机白名单:在杀毒软件中排除虚拟机进程
- 启用BitLocker加密:对虚拟磁盘进行全盘加密
3 跨平台兼容性配置
- Linux子系统支持:在虚拟机设置中启用"Linux子系统"
- Docker容器集成:安装Hyper-V Integration Services
- GPU passthrough:配置NVIDIA vGPU分配方案
- 虚拟网络配置:创建NAT模式网络(端口映射规则)
常见问题深度排查(655字) 6.1 典型故障场景及解决方案 | 故障现象 | 可能原因 | 解决方案 | |-------------------------|------------------------------|-----------------------------------| | 黑屏无响应 | 图形驱动冲突 | 使用安全模式安装 | | 无法激活系统 | 虚拟机MAC地址被识别为非法 | 更新虚拟机网络适配器驱动 | | 系统更新失败 | 虚拟磁盘空间不足 | 扩展虚拟磁盘并清理更新缓存 | | 多系统启动项混乱 | BCD文件损坏 | 使用bootrec /fixboot命令修复 | | 磁盘空间显示异常 | 虚拟磁盘快照占用过多 | 使用vboxmanage revert殊处理快照 |
2 虚拟机特有的兼容性问题
- 驱动冲突:禁用虚拟机特有的驱动(如Intel Management Engine)
- 时区错误:强制同步Windows时间服务(
w32tm /resync
) - 输入法异常:安装Microsoft Input Method Manager
- 多语言支持:创建多语言环境分区(需先安装系统语言包)
3 系统性能监控指标
- 内存使用率:保持低于80%(建议监控工具:Process Explorer)
- 磁盘IOPS:SSD虚拟磁盘应低于5000 IOPS
- CPU Ready时间:应低于5%(通过任务管理器性能选项卡)
- 网络延迟:确保小于10ms(使用ping命令测试)
进阶技巧与行业实践(449字) 7.1 虚拟机集群部署方案
- 使用Windows Server 2016集群功能
- 配置Hyper-V集群存储(使用iSCSI或SAN)
- 设置集群心跳检测(默认3秒间隔)
- 灾备方案:快照备份+克隆副本
2 虚拟机性能基准测试
- 系统启动时间:记录从开机到桌面加载完成的时间
- 应用性能测试:使用LoadRunner模拟100用户并发
- 磁盘吞吐量测试:使用fio工具生成IO负载
- 系统资源利用率:使用VMware vCenter或Hyper-V Manager监控
3 行业应用场景案例
- 测试环境搭建:为Web应用开发提供多版本Windows测试环境
- 安全攻防演练:在隔离环境中进行渗透测试
- 跨平台开发:同时运行Windows Subsystem for Linux
- 教育培训:通过虚拟机实现操作系统教学演示
0 总结与展望(126字) 本教程系统性地梳理了虚拟机安装Windows 10的全生命周期管理,特别针对Boot Manager相关故障提供了原创解决方案,随着Windows 11的发布,建议关注以下趋势:硬件虚拟化增强(V2V技术)、容器化部署(Hyper-V Container)、云原生虚拟化(Azure Stack)等发展方向。
(全文技术参数更新至2023年10月,兼容Windows 10 21H2及主流虚拟化平台)
本文链接:https://www.zhitaoyun.cn/2151030.html
发表评论